April is a big month for plantings and other projects that involve digging. That’s why it’s also National Safe Digging Month.  Before you start digging, one simple step can prevent property damage – or worse.

Call 811 at least two business days before you start a big dig on your property.

There’s no cost to you and it’s required by law.

One phone call to 811 will help you dig safely.  The owners of any underground facilities, like natural gas pipes and electric wires, will be notified and mark their locations.  Calling 811 automatically routes you directly to the one call center in your area within the United States.  The state map below provides you with additional details on each 811 center as well as specific guidelines for your state.
